Hummel Goebel Piglets & Boy Wearing Red Cap and his Father’s Slippers W. Germany

Hummel Goebel “Farm Boy #66” Porcelain Boy with Two Piglets. He is wearing a red cap, red scarf, blue jacket, shorts, and what appears to be his father’s slippers. Made in West Germany, in the mid 20th century. The approximate dimensions are 6 inches tall x 4 across. The maker’s mark is on the bottom of the sculpture. Does not include original box.
